Scale refers to the relationship of a Scale refers to the relationship of a feature’s size on a map to its actual feature’s size on a map to its actual size on earth. size on earth.
It is represented in three ways:It is represented in three ways:A ratio or fractionA ratio or fractionA written scaleA written scaleA graphic scaleA graphic scale
![Page 8: Geography Earth To write The study of where and why human activities are located where they are (i.e. religions, businesses, and cities) The study of.](https://reader036.fdocuments.net/reader036/viewer/2022081519/56649cba5503460f94982262/html5/thumbnails/8.jpg)
A ratio or fraction:This shows the numerical ratio between
distances on the map and Earth’s surface.1:24,000 or 1/24,000 means that 1 unit
(usually an inch) on the map represents 24,000 of the same unit on the ground.
This is also called the RF scale or representative fraction.

1. Robinson Projection
Pro: Useful in displaying information across oceans along longitude lines
Con: Shows a larger proportion of water to land than actuality
![Page 25: Geography Earth To write The study of where and why human activities are located where they are (i.e. religions, businesses, and cities) The study of.](https://reader036.fdocuments.net/reader036/viewer/2022081519/56649cba5503460f94982262/html5/thumbnails/25.jpg)
2. Mercator Projection Pro: works for
navigation around the Equator
Con: area is extremely distorted towards the poles
![Page 26: Geography Earth To write The study of where and why human activities are located where they are (i.e. religions, businesses, and cities) The study of.](https://reader036.fdocuments.net/reader036/viewer/2022081519/56649cba5503460f94982262/html5/thumbnails/26.jpg)
3. Equal Area Projections
Azimuthal and Goode’s Interrupted HomolosinePro: Very little distortion to landmassesCon: Discontinuities in oceanic regions

4. Choropleth maps
•Applies distinctive colors to represent different quantities or densities
•Typically on a map of a formal region (political)
![Page 32: Geography Earth To write The study of where and why human activities are located where they are (i.e. religions, businesses, and cities) The study of.](https://reader036.fdocuments.net/reader036/viewer/2022081519/56649cba5503460f94982262/html5/thumbnails/32.jpg)
![Page 33: Geography Earth To write The study of where and why human activities are located where they are (i.e. religions, businesses, and cities) The study of.](https://reader036.fdocuments.net/reader036/viewer/2022081519/56649cba5503460f94982262/html5/thumbnails/33.jpg)
5. Dot distribution/Dot Density map
Shows distribution using a concentration of dots
Each dot represents the same quantity
Used for population density
![Page 34: Geography Earth To write The study of where and why human activities are located where they are (i.e. religions, businesses, and cities) The study of.](https://reader036.fdocuments.net/reader036/viewer/2022081519/56649cba5503460f94982262/html5/thumbnails/34.jpg)
6. Isopleth of Isoline maps •Used to portray
quantities that vary smoothly over a given area
•Joins locations with the same value
•Used for climate variables
![Page 35: Geography Earth To write The study of where and why human activities are located where they are (i.e. religions, businesses, and cities) The study of.](https://reader036.fdocuments.net/reader036/viewer/2022081519/56649cba5503460f94982262/html5/thumbnails/35.jpg)
7. Proportional symbol map
•Portrays numerical quantities
•Symbols are drawn proportional to the value at that location
![Page 36: Geography Earth To write The study of where and why human activities are located where they are (i.e. religions, businesses, and cities) The study of.](https://reader036.fdocuments.net/reader036/viewer/2022081519/56649cba5503460f94982262/html5/thumbnails/36.jpg)
8. Cartogram
Deliberately distort map shapes to achieve special effects

U.S. Land Ordinance of 1785-divided the country into a system of townships and ranges to facilitate the sale of land in the West
![Page 43: Geography Earth To write The study of where and why human activities are located where they are (i.e. religions, businesses, and cities) The study of.](https://reader036.fdocuments.net/reader036/viewer/2022081519/56649cba5503460f94982262/html5/thumbnails/43.jpg)
•Township- square composed of 6 miles/side
•Principle meridians- north-south lines separating townships
•Base lines- east- west lines separating townships
•Section- township is divided into 36 of these, 1 mi by 1 mi
•Quarter-section- .5 mi by .5 mi or 160 acres, considered a homestead to pioneers
